Rev. Dr. Jeffrey K. Boer
Hialeah, Florida, U.S.A.
Dr.
Jeffrey Boer has been the second longest-standing board member of RCM, having
joined in 1988. He was then the pastor of
Sharon Orthodox
Presbyterian Church (OPC), as he remains to this day. He was born in
Sanborn, Iowa as the second of seven children and raised as a Christian. He
married his wife Barbara Jean Kramm, a daughter of OPC elder Robert Kramm (now
deceased). His wife has recently been appointed (effective July, 2008) as the
Headmaster at Bethany Christian School in Ft. Lauderdale, Florida (the oldest
Reformed Christian school in Florida). He graduated from Dordt College with a
B.A. in Psychology/Sociology; from Westminster Theological Seminary in 1979 with
a Master of Divinity and from Whitefield Theological Seminary in 1993 with a
Doctor of Ministry.
Dr. Boer has been instrumental in assisting us in the
development of RCM's college and seminary program and also has been an important
aid and consultant through many times of great trial. RCM's Rev. Donnan had the
privilege of introducing him to one of our other board members, Mr. Raul Montes,
back in 1988. Mr. Montes now serves as an elder in Sharon Orthodox Presbyterian
Church.
Dr. Boer serves on the executive committee of RCM's college and
seminary programs, and also serves as a member of the Doctoral Committee
responsible for making decisions with respect to doctoral candidates.
He has two sons, Casey Daniel born in 1983 and Jordan David born
in 1986. They both were home schooled and now work in South Florida.
